Janet Schloss is a scholar working on Complementary and alternative medicine, Physiology and Pharmacology. According to data from OpenAlex, Janet Schloss has authored 63 papers receiving a total of 834 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Complementary and alternative medicine, 10 papers in Physiology and 9 papers in Pharmacology. Recurrent topics in Janet Schloss's work include Complementary and Alternative Medicine Studies (19 papers), Therapeutic Uses of Natural Elements (7 papers) and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(6 papers). Janet Schloss is often cited by papers focused on Complementary and Alternative Medicine Studies (19 papers), Therapeutic Uses of Natural Elements (7 papers) and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(6 papers). Janet Schloss coll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and France. Janet Schloss's co-authors include David Sibbritt, Jessica Bayes, Amie Steel, Maree Colosimo, Luis Vitetta, Paul P. Masci, Anthony W. Linnane, Matthew Leach, Jon Adams and Jon Wardle and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and American Journal of Clinical Nutrition.
